More about The Family Sowell

Overview of Bluegrass musician The Family Sowell

The Family Sowell, a country and bluegrass band from Knoxville, Tennessee, has been causing a stir in the music world with their distinctive sound and genuine approach to music-making. The Family Sowell is a group of gifted musicians that are deeply passionate about classic country and bluegrass music. They have won over many fans with their heartfelt lyrics, soulful harmonies, and amazing instrumentation.

Their sound is a fusion of traditional country and bluegrass with a modern touch, creating a sound that is both nostalgic and new. The music of The Family Sowell is a celebration of life, love, and all of its ups and downs. Their music is full of lyrics that speak to the listener's soul and speak to the human experience.

The Family Sowell have amassed a devoted fan base who value their sincere approach to music-making thanks to their unquestionable talent and dedication to their profession. Their live performances are proof of their prowess and showmanship; they captivate audiences and leave them wanting more. The Family Sowell is a true treasure in the world of country and bluegrass music, and everyone who hears their music will be profoundly affected.

What are the latest songs and music albums for Bluegrass musician The Family Sowell?

With their most recent albums, the American country and bluegrass band The Family Sowell has been engrossing their audience. They already have three albums out in 2022, including "K-Town Christmas," "Story to Tell," and "Time Travel." For all aficionados of country and bluegrass music, these CDs are a must-listen as they demonstrate the band's musical diversity and passion.

The Family Sowell has recently released a few singles in addition to their albums. The following are scheduled releases: "Love Is the Key" (2020), "I Am the Man, Thomas" (2019), "Good, Good Father" (2019), and "Softly and Tenderly" (2019). These tracks perfectly encapsulate the band's distinctive sound, which combines classic bluegrass and contemporary country.
